Clinical and laboratory risk factors of thrombotic complications after pacemaker implantation: a prospective study

Pacemaker implantation induces a transient hypercoagulable state, but its degree does not predict subsequent venous thromboembolism, and neither did the grade of endothelial damage as reflected by plasma markers. The aetiology of these lesions seems to be multifactorial, and clustering of classic thrombotic risk factors plays a role in the pathogenesis.
